Your Impact

Do you want to join a team that is at the forefront of a once-in-a-lifetime programme, are you looking to take the next step in your career, or is it time for a new challenge in business winning? If so, we have an exciting opportunity within our Future Combat Air business for a Senior Bid Manager.

The Future Combat Air (FCA) bid team is responsible for leading cross-functional teams in the generation and submission of complex multi-million-pound commercial offers that meet time, cost and quality requirements. You will be responsible for the formulation of bid strategies, building and leading bid teams to develop solutions for our customers that are deliverable, as well as ensuring that the offer meets programmatic and business needs.

As the Senior Bid Manager, you have accountability for the overall quality of bid submissions and will guide the team through the internal governance and approval gates, ensuring that relevant business winning information is presented to the FCA leadership team. This will require excellent planning and stakeholder management skills. As a Senior Bid Manager, you will coordinate inputs from multiple teams and work with Sector Vice Presidents, the FCA Head of Bids, Integrated Project Team Leads, Engineering, and Commercial Managers to define the bid strategy and then ensure its execution.

This role is based at our Luton site with occasional UK travel to other Leonardo and customer sites, as well as potential international travel. We operate a custom working hybrid model and offer flexible working to support your wellbeing and work‑life balance. We expect you to work from our Luton office two to three times per week on average, but this can vary depending on business needs and your schedule.

What you’ll do as a Senior Bid Manager:
  • Leadership of bids through to successful conclusion, ranging from tactical follow‑on business through to multi‑million-pound strategic initiatives

  • Coordinate and manage bids with a range of complexities throughout the capture and bid phases of the lifecycle

  • Work in collaboration with customers and internal stakeholders, applying best practice, to formulate bid strategies, and drive bid teams to find winning solutions

  • Schedule and drive bid activities including Win Strategy, Bid Kick‑off, Answer Planning, Bid Progress Reviews, Proposal production, Proposal content collation, Proposal reviews (e.g. colour reviews) and Tender Approvals

  • Plan, lead, and challenge cost build‑up and pricing activities from business functions

  • Lead bid teams to identify and analyse risks and opportunities, developing mitigation/realisation plans for action post‑contract award

  • Forecast functional resource and budget requirements on bids you lead, proactively managing approved bid budgets

  • Support the capture team during the contract negotiation phase, managing and implementing changes required to our bid submission to secure contract award

  • Manage and contribute to the writing of proposal material, drawing on the skills and experience of capture team members and subject matter experts

What you’ll bring:
  • Experience managing complex bids and proposals

  • Proven track record in winning business (preferably experience of leading bids with values of £20m+), with strong commercial, project, and risk management skills

  • Experience managing multi‑functional teams (preferably in a Bid Management or Business Winning discipline)

  • Excellent planning, organisation, and time management skills (to achieve bid milestones)

  • Degree‑level qualification or equivalent, with demonstrable bid management knowledge (APMP Foundation Certification or above is desirable)

  • Ability to lead and collaborate with cross‑functional teams that may be geographically dispersed

  • Ability to assess complex requirements and communicate effectively with stakeholders at all levels

  • Leadership experience, including coaching, mentoring, team management, and team building skills

  • Interpersonal skills to develop close business relationships with internal and external stakeholders, senior management, and government/military customers

  • The ability to communicate effectively at all levels within the wider business and with external consortia

  • Have a working understanding of best practice bid processes and tools (e.g. for bid planning, Black Hat, Red Team, Price to Win, etc.)

Security Clearance

This role is subject to pre‑employment screening in line with the UK Government’s Baseline Personnel

Security Standard (BPSS). An additional range of Personnel Security Controls referred to as National Security Vetting (NSV) may apply, this could include meeting the eligibility requirements for the Security Check (SC) or Developed Vetting (DV). For more information and guidance please visit:
